Absecon Council adopts Ordinance 02-2025 to exceed budget appropriations limit and establish cap bank
Summary
The Absecon City Council unanimously adopted Ordinance 02-2025 allowing the municipality to exceed the budget appropriations limit and establish a cap bank; the measure passed on final reading after a roll-call vote and was declared approved.

The Absecon City Council adopted Ordinance 02-2025 on final reading, authorizing the city to exceed its municipal budget appropriations limit and to establish a cap bank.
The ordinance was read for a second time and put to a vote; following a motion and second, the presiding officer called for a roll-call vote. The clerk recorded votes in favor and the presiding officer stated, “this ordinance has been heard and is finally approved.”
Why it matters: The ordinance allows the city to carry forward unused municipal cap from one year to another, giving the governing body flexibility to manage spending limits under the state’s municipal finance rules. Council members said the measure was a technical but important step for 2025 budget planning.
Council action and next steps: The council approved the ordinance by roll call. No amendments or separate public testimony were recorded during the final-reading sequence; the ordinance will take effect according to municipal procedure. The clerk and administrative staff will incorporate the change into the 2025 budget process.
